Where to go near Saylorville Lake

  • Ankeny: Located 5 miles from Saylorville Lake, Ankeny is an excellent choice for families seeking outdoor and adventure experiences. Popular attractions include Adventureland, an amusement park perfect for thrill-seekers, and Prairie Ridge Sports Complex, an urban park ideal for family outings. The city also features educational venues like Des Moines Area Community College, making it a well-rounded destination for various interests.
  • Urbandale: Situated 7 miles from Saylorville Lake, Urbandale attracts visitors for its family-friendly city atmosphere and business opportunities. The shopping mall center offers a variety of retail options, while the Casey's Center provides entertainment through its arena facilities. Notable landmarks include the Living History Farms, showcasing agricultural heritage, and Drake University, a modern college campus offering a vibrant urban vibe.
  • Johnston: Just 4 miles from Saylorville Lake, Johnston is perfect for those who enjoy outdoor activities and scenic views. The city is home to Saylorville Lake itself, which offers a beautiful setting for relaxation and recreation. In addition, visitors can explore the Casey's Center for entertainment and Drake University, which adds to the city's educational appeal. Johnston's blend of outdoor experiences and city amenities makes it an inviting place to stay.

10 tips to save on your Saylorville Lake car hire

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le types and features. Whether you're looking for an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er drives, or an economy car for budget-friendly options, using filters on Expedia can help you discover the perfect match for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ates vary with demand, so it's advisable to secure your car well ahead of your trip. By booking early, you're more likely to obtain lower rates and enjoy greater availability, particularly during peak se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ller vehicles typically come at a lower rental price and are eas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als strike a good balance between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or luxury models—might not be available. This can also apply to renters over 70. Always verify the age requirements before you book.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ate on a full-to-full fuel policy, meaning you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ional charges. This is usually the most favorable option. Others might offer full-to-empty or prepaid fueling arrangements, which are acceptable as well; just ensure you return the car empty in that case.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ience may justify the extra cost.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provide peace of mind if something unforeseen occurs during your trip. It's easy to add car rental insurance when booking through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you're planning extensive road trips, look for r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ent incurring extra char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a car.
